Forecast: Antidepressant Medicine Sales in Italy

Antidepressant Medicine Sales Analysis

From 2013 to 2016, antidepressant medicine sales in Italy experienced a consistent decline, with the most significant drop occurring between 2014 and 2015 (-21.74%). However, from 2017 onwards, sales stabilized around 1.7 units through 2023, showing no year-on-year variation. For the current year (2023), the value stands at 1.7 units.

Looking ahead, the forecast indicates a slight decrease starting in 2024, reaching 1.5 units by 2028. The forecasted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) for the next five years is -1.28%, indicating a minor annual decline.

Future trends to watch for include potential impacts of new treatment options, changes in healthcare policies, and increased awareness of mental health, which could influence antidepressant sales dynamics.
